Cow and gate good night milk


i was just wondering if anyone uses it, and what you think of it?

did you see any results straight away or did it take a couple of days?

haven't tried C&G good night milk but did try a free sample of the HiPP version. She hated it. Made her really gripey and gave her tummy ache pretty quickly due to all the cereals and stuff in it. She had a crap night sleep with it. I decided against using it because if she wakes up in the night its because her dummy has fallen out not through hunger so realised her normal milk is satisfying her enough.

I tried the cow and gate night forumla when tom was about 10 months old as he still wasnt sleeping through and it was because he was hungry.
It worked for us and he loved it. It didnt give him any bad side affects or anything.
